Linux ubuntu22 5.15.0-133-generic #144-Ubuntu SMP Fri Feb 7 20:47:38 UTC 2025 x86_64
nginx/1.18.0
: 128.199.27.159 | : 216.73.216.1
Cant Read [ /etc/named.conf ]
8.1.31
www-data
www.github.com/MadExploits
Terminal
AUTO ROOT
Adminer
Backdoor Destroyer
Linux Exploit
Lock Shell
Lock File
Create User
CREATE RDP
PHP Mailer
BACKCONNECT
UNLOCK SHELL
HASH IDENTIFIER
CPANEL RESET
CREATE WP USER
README
+ Create Folder
+ Create File
/
home /
amatya /
quiz1 /
node_modules /
w3c-xmlserializer /
[ HOME SHELL ]
Name
Size
Permission
Action
lib
[ DIR ]
dr-xr-xr-x
LICENSE.md
1.08
KB
-rw-rw-rw-
README.md
1.65
KB
-rw-rw-rw-
package.json
573
B
-rw-rw-rw-
Delete
Unzip
Zip
${this.title}
Close
Code Editor : README.md
# w3c-xmlserializer An XML serializer that follows the [W3C specification](https://w3c.github.io/DOM-Parsing/). This package can be used in Node.js, as long as you feed it a DOM node, e.g. one produced by [jsdom](https://github.com/jsdom/jsdom). ## Basic usage Assume you have a DOM tree rooted at a node `node`. In Node.js, you could create this using [jsdom](https://github.com/jsdom/jsdom) as follows: ```js const { JSDOM } = require("jsdom"); const { document } = new JSDOM().window; const node = document.createElement("akomaNtoso"); ``` Then, you use this package as follows: ```js const serialize = require("w3c-xmlserializer"); console.log(serialize(node)); // => '<akomantoso xmlns="http://www.w3.org/1999/xhtml"></akomantoso>' ``` ## `requireWellFormed` option By default the input DOM tree is not required to be "well-formed"; any given input will serialize to some output string. You can instead require well-formedness via ```js serialize(node, { requireWellFormed: true }); ``` which will cause `Error`s to be thrown when non-well-formed constructs are encountered. [Per the spec](https://w3c.github.io/DOM-Parsing/#dfn-require-well-formed), this largely is about imposing constraints on the names of elements, attributes, etc. As a point of reference, on the web platform: * The [`innerHTML` getter](https://w3c.github.io/DOM-Parsing/#dom-innerhtml-innerhtml) uses the require-well-formed mode, i.e. trying to get the `innerHTML` of non-well-formed subtrees will throw. * The [`xhr.send()` method](https://xhr.spec.whatwg.org/#the-send()-method) does not require well-formedness, i.e. sending non-well-formed `Document`s will serialize and send them anyway.
Close